About this book
At the end of The Day of the Triffids the hero Bill Masen his wife and four-year-old son leave the British mainland to join a new colony on the Isle of Wight. The Night of the Triffids takes up the story 25 years later. David Masen the now grown-up son of Bill is a pilot still searching for a method of destroying the implacable triffid plant as it continues its worldwide march seemingly intent on wiping out humankind. David eventually manages to reach New York where a very different sort of colony has been set up a colony whose members seem to be immune to the triffid string and where David comes face to face with an old enemy from his fathers past.
